Description

As the MEP Project Manager, the successful candidate will be responsible to oversee the MEP superintendents and implementation of on-site work for all components of a construction project related to mechanical, electrical and plumbing systems.

Essential Accountabilities
  • Oversee on-site work to manage internal MEP staff and subcontractors involved with mechanical, electrical, and plumbing work on a daily basis on specific project.
  • Intimate familiarity with pharmaceutical and healthcare facilities and the planning involved with working in an active GMP or process facility.
  • Oversee schedule, budget, and tasks corresponding to the Construction, Post-Construction, and Maintenance phases of a project.
  • Work with safety director to ensure proper safety procedures.
  • Work with project team to develop schedules for MEP trades.
  • Able to review Preconstruction technical documents to ensure work is accurately portrayed and complete in scope based on an understanding of the overall scope and intent.
  • Assist purchasing with coordination of systems and buyout of major MEP contracts. Support development of scope of work descriptions.
  • Understanding and competency with commissioning and certification of GMP Pharmaceutical facilities.
Work Experience
  • 15+ years of experience working with mechanical, electrical and plumbing
  • Ability to read plans and specifications and perform quantity surveys.
  • Understanding of Construction Systems and CSI codes.
  • Working knowledge of building codes and ADA laws
  • 30 OSHA training
  • Familiar with GMP and FDA practices, commissioning, and certification of pharmaceutical process plants
  • Significant experience and strong understanding of the costs associated with mechanical, electrical, and plumbing equipment.
Qualifications

BS Degree in construction, engineering or equivalent experience.
